Launch Date & Global Availability
The Poco F7 is scheduled to launch worldwide on June 24, 2025, including a simultaneous India debut. The smartphone will run HyperOS 2, Xiaomi’s latest Android 15-based user interface, optimized for fluidity and battery efficiency.
Design & Display
The Poco F7 comes with a flat-frame metallic design, ultra-slim bezels, and a premium matte finish back with a dual-camera island. It’s available in Black, White, and a Special Silver Edition with a translucent, circuit-etched finish.
The front features a 6.83-inch 1.5K AMOLED panel, a 120 Hz refresh rate, and a peak brightness of 3,200 nits—perfect for bright outdoor visibility. Dolby Vision, HDR10+, IP68 water resistance, and stereo speakers with Dolby Atmos make this a multimedia powerhouse.
🔋 Battery & Charging
One of the Poco F7’s standout specs is its 7,550 mAh battery (India model) — one of the largest in the premium mid-range category. The global variant may carry a slightly smaller 6,500 mAh unit due to regulatory certifications.
Charging speeds are equally impressive with 90W wired fast charging and 22.5W reverse wired charging, a rare feature in this segment.
⚙️ Performance & Hardware
Under the hood, the Poco F7 is powered by the Snapdragon 8s Gen 4, built on a 4nm TSMC process, paired with up to 12GB LPDDR5X RAM and 512GB UFS 4.1 storage.
In Geekbench 6, it scores around 1,937 (single-core) and 6,021 (multi-core), almost on par with the Poco F7 Pro. The performance is tailored for gaming, multitasking, and heavy usage without thermal throttling.
📸 Camera Setup
The Poco F7 is expected to sport a 50MP Sony IMX882 primary sensor with OIS, an 8MP ultra-wide lens, and a 20MP front camera. While the specs aren’t groundbreaking, the software tuning in HyperOS 2 is expected to enhance image quality, especially in low light.
💰 Expected Price in India
Sources suggest that the Poco F7’s 12GB + 512GB variant will be priced around ₹40,000–₹45,000 in India, placing it squarely against OnePlus Nord 4, Nothing Phone 3, and the Realme GT series.
